What is RAG AI?
RAG AI is a sophisticated blend of two distinct AI technologies: retrieval systems and generative models. The what is RAG in AI concept involves a detailed technical architecture that combines these systems to enhance the quality of generated responses.
- Technical Overview of RAG Architecture: RAG AI leverages vast databases to retrieve pertinent information, which is then used by generative models to create contextually relevant content.
- How RAG Differs from Traditional AI Models: Unlike traditional AI, which relies solely on pre-trained data, RAG AI dynamically accesses external data sources to refine its outputs.
- Key Components of RAG Technology: The architecture primarily consists of a retriever and a generator, working in tandem to provide precise and personalized content.
